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Sapele's airport?
If you’re arriving by air, you won’t have to worry which airport to choose. Sapele has just one – Warri Airport (QRW).
How far is Warri Airport from central Sapele?
Lengthy commutes don’t have to be stressful if you consider your options ahead of time. Downtown Sapele is 40 kilometers from Osubi Airstrip, so it’s smart to know how to get to the city before you touchdown.
What airport is best to fly into Sapele?
With one major airport operating in Sapele, it won’t take you long to get your hands on the best flight. You’ll be jetting off to Osubi Airstrip, which is located around 40 kilometers from the center of town.
How many airlines fly to Sapele?
With 2 air carriers jetting into Sapele from 2 airports across the world, your next adventure is only a few clicks away.
Which airlines fly to Sapele?
Air Peace and Overland Airways offer the largest proportion of flights to Sapele. One of the most preferred ways to get there is on an Air Peace flight leaving from Lagos.
How many nonstop flights are there to Sapele?
With 23 direct flights running every week, you’ll be hitting the tarmac in Sapele before you can say, “Are we there yet?”
Where are the most popular flights to Sapele departing from?
While people fly from all corners of the earth to visit Sapele, the most popular flights jet off from Lagos and Abuja.
How long is the flight to Sapele Airport?
Flights from Lagos to Sapele are typically 53 minutes. Or you could leave from Abuja instead, which would mean you’ll be onboard for around 55 minutes.

How to survive the flight to Sapele?
If you’re poorly prepared, traveling can be daunting. But don’t hit the panic button just yet. Follow these handy tips for a hassle-free start to your getaway in Sapele.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• The trick to having an amazing flight experience is to be prepared. So, let’s start with the essentials: passport, boarding pass, bank cards and medications. Next, bring on board items that’ll help keep you entertained, like some electronic gadgets or a thrilling book. It’s also smart to pack your chargers, a quality neck pillow and a pair of headphones. And of course, be sure to toss in toiletries like a toothbrush, facial wipes and a fresh set of clothes.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of prohibited items can differ between airlines, the general rule to follow is avoid carrying anything flammable, sharp or explosive. This includes things like box cutters, razor blades, aerosol cans and flares. Sports equipment like ski poles, and objects that could harm other people, such as guns and swords, can’t come on board with you either.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Comfort really should be your main priority when choosing what to wear on your flight. Consider your footwear choice with care too, as swelling of the feet and ankles are a common side effect of flying. Flat shoes which are slightly roomy are always a good idea.
  • Unfortunately, one risk of long-distance flying is developing DVT (deep vein thrombosis), a blood clot condition caused by prolonged inactivity. To prevent this, make the most of every opportunity to wander around the cabin. Compression socks and tights are another simple way to help lower your risk.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Sapele?
Being organized before you get to the airport will make your trip to Sapele quick and painless. Read through our useful tips for a speedy journey past security:

  • Be sure to keep your ID and travel documents within close reach. They’re the first items you’ll be asked to present to security.
  • Your jacket, belt, keys and other items in your pocket, like your earphones, will need to go on a tray through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process easier by removing them before your turn arrives.
  • All electronic gadgets, including your phone and laptop, must also be scanned.
  • Any liquids or gels, such as shampoo or hairspray, that you want to bring on board must be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ters). Also, they all must fit inside a quart-size (one liter), clear zip-lock bag.
  • It’s also likely that you’ll be asked to take your shoes off for scanning, so wearing lightweight sneakers is always a good idea.
  • Avoid taking prohibited items in your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p or pointed objects, put them in your checked luggage. They won’t be allowed in the cabin.
